2011 Ravines Wine Cellars Dry Riesling Argetsinger Vineyard

Community Tasting Note

  • TC16 wrote: 90 points

    March 21, 2015 - Angular and focused acidity. Lemon and lime citris. Did I mention acidity? Wet stone and minerality in mid-palate. Hint of cream and perhaps butterscotch at the end that I tend to associate with Argetsinger. Very nice FL riesling.
